"Kata

"It should be known that the secret principles
of Goju-Ryu exist within the kata."
Master Chojun Miyagi - Founder of Goju-Ryu

"Kata" are not simply an exhibition of form. They are a concrete manifestation of techniques which can be transformed at any time to any form. It is in the kata that the essence of karate has assumed a definite form. We should always remember that the kata are a crystallization of the essence of karate and that we should always begin afresh and train hard. It is only through the training of kata that you will reach "gokui", the essential teachings.
